Led by Rodolphe Saadé, the CMA CGM Group, a global leader in shipping and logistics, serves more than 420 ports around the world on five continents. With its subsidiary CEVA Logistics, a world leader in logistics, and its air freight division CMA CGM AIR CARGO, the CMA CGM Group is continually innovating to offer its customers a complete and increasingly efficient range of new shipping, land, air and logistics solutions.

Committed to the energy transition in shipping, and a pioneer in the use of alternative fuels, the CMA CGM Group has set a target to become Net Zero Carbon by 2050.
Through the CMA CGM Foundation, the Group acts in humanitarian crises that require an emergency response by mobilizing the Group's shipping and logistics expertise to bring humanitarian supplies around the world.

Present in 160 countries through its network of more than 400 offices and 750 warehouses, the Group employs more than 155,000 people worldwide, including 4,000 in Marseilles where its head office is located.

Job Summary:
We are seeking an experienced Project Manager (PM) to provide strategic and operational support to the HR Leadership Team (HRLT), with a focus on Total Rewards and overall HR initiatives. This role will be responsible for guiding HR projects, identifying and enabling improvement opportunities, and ensuring alignment with HO guidance and strategic business objectives. The PM will also play a crucial role in optimizing processes, and ensuring successful project execution in a fast-paced HR environment.


Key Responsibilities:

Project Management:

  • Plan, execute, and oversee HR projects, ensuring they are completed on time, within scope, and within budget.
  • Develop detailed project plans, including timelines, milestones, and resource allocation.
  • Coordinate internal resources and third parties/vendors for the flawless execution of projects.
  • Monitor and track project progress, providing regular updates to stakeholders.

HR Support:

  • Collaborate with HR team members to identify and implement process improvements.
  • Support the development and implementation of HR policies and procedures.
  • Assist in the coordination of HR initiatives, such as employee engagement programs, performance management, and talent development.

Total Rewards:

  • Support the design, implementation, and administration of Total Rewards programs, including compensation, benefits, and recognition programs.
  • Conduct market research and benchmarking to ensure competitive and equitable compensation and benefits offerings.
  • Assist in the communication of Total Rewards programs to employees, ensuring clarity and understanding.

Stakeholder Management:

  • Act as a liaison between HR, employees, and management to ensure smooth project execution.
  • Facilitate effective communication and collaboration among project stakeholders.
  • Address and resolve project-related issues and conflicts in a timely manner.

Documentation and Reporting:

  • Maintain comprehensive project documentation, including project charters, status reports, and post-project evaluations.
  • Prepare and present project status reports, including risks, issues, and mitigation plans.

Qualifications & Skills:

  • Minimum 10 years of progressive experience in Project Management and/or HR project roles.
  • Strong time management skills with the ability to prioritize tasks effectively.
  • Excellent professional communication and interpersonal skills.
  • Ability to work independently as well as collaboratively within a cross-functional team.
  • Knowledge of HR best practices, HR systems, and employment compliance.
  • Expert proficiency in Excel (Data Organization, Pivot Tables, V-Lookup, etc.).
